How much do assistant culinary instructor j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 6, 2026, the average hourly pay for assistant culinary instructor in California is $24.30,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$19.90 and $27.50 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Assistant Culinary Instructor vs Culinary Instructor?

AspectAssistant Culinary InstructorCulinary Instructor
Required CredentialsCooking certifications, culinary degree often preferredAdvanced culinary certifications, teaching credentials may be beneficial
Work EnvironmentCooking schools, community colleges, culinary programsCooking schools, culinary colleges, vocational institutes
Employer & Industry UsageAssists lead instructors, supports curriculum deliveryLeads classes, develops lesson plans, evaluates students

The main difference between an Assistant Culinary Instructor and a Culinary Instructor lies in their responsibilities and experience level. The assistant supports the lead instructor and focuses on assisting with classes, while the culinary instructor leads lessons and manages curriculum development. Both roles require culinary skills and certifications, but the instructor position typically demands more experience and teaching credentials.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an assistant culinary instructor?

To thrive as an Assistant Culinary Instructor, you need a solid culinary background, experience in food preparation, and often a relevant certification such as ServSafe or a culinary arts degree. Familiarity with commercial kitchen equipment, recipe management software, and safety protocols is typically required. Strong communication, patience, and the ability to motivate and instruct students are standout soft skills in this role. These abilities ensure effective teaching, a safe learning environment, and student success in culinary training programs.

What does an assistant culinary instructor do?

Assistant Culinary Instructors play a vital role in ensuring smooth class operations by helping set up workstations, preparing ingredients, and demonstrating basic cooking techniques. They actively assist students with hands-on tasks, answer questions, and provide timely feedback to reinforce learning. Additionally, they support lead instructors by monitoring safety and cleanliness standards, and often help assess student progress. This collaborative environment allows assistants to develop their teaching skills while contributing to a positive, engaging learning experience.

What is an assistant culinary instructor?

Assistant Culinary Instructors are professionals who support lead culinary instructors in teaching cooking techniques, kitchen safety, and food preparation to students. They help set up workstations, demonstrate recipes, supervise students during hands-on activities, and ensure a clean, safe learning environment. Their role is vital in providing guidance, answering questions, and reinforcing lessons, making them an essential part of culinary education programs.
